And according to the Forecaster, nobody has really complained about it. Not commuters, not boaters, not tourists. People see it and think, "that is one huge snow pile" and keep on their merry way. The Forecaster went as far as to ask some experts when the snow pile would melt, and they suggested it will take until Memorial Day. How's that for a tourist attraction?

Oh, and the city of Portland plans on using the same spot next year.
